Ejecutar la misma pila web en AWS, Azure y Google Cloud rara vez produce el mismo comportamiento en producción. La diferencia se manifiesta en cómo se enruta, se reintenta y se recupera el tráfico. Los servicios de red basados en la nube se convierten en la capa de control que determina si el rendimiento se mantiene constante o varía bajo carga.
La latencia está determinada por las decisiones de enrutamiento
La latencia en entornos multinube viene determinada por las rutas de enrutamiento.
Las redes troncales de los proveedores priorizan el tráfico dentro de la nube. Las solicitudes entre nubes pueden tomar rutas más largas, especialmente cuando los puntos de entrada y las ubicaciones de borde difieren. Los puntos de terminación TLS y las políticas de reutilización de conexiones también varían, lo que añade pequeños retrasos que se acumulan con el tráfico real.
Una solución web basada en la nube muestra tiempos de respuesta desiguales según la región, incluso cuando la capacidad de procesamiento y almacenamiento es estable. La diferencia se hace visible en el TTFB y la latencia de la API, en lugar de en fallos directos.
El comportamiento de enrutamiento difiere entre los proveedores
El equilibrio de carga y el enrutamiento se implementan de forma diferente en las distintas nubes. Las comprobaciones de estado, el drenaje de conexiones y la lógica de reintentos no están armonizados.
Un proveedor puede considerar que un servidor backend funciona correctamente basándose en comprobaciones TCP, mientras que otro requiere respuestas a nivel de aplicación. Durante la degradación, el tráfico continúa fluyendo hacia nodos que deberían haber sido eliminados de la rotación. Esto aumenta la latencia de cola y genera un rendimiento inconsistente entre regiones.
Estas diferencias rara vez son visibles en pruebas controladas. Se hacen evidentes durante los picos de carga o los cortes parciales del suministro eléctrico.
Fallos de conmutación por error en los extremos
La conmutación por error depende de la sincronización entre sistemas que no comparten el mismo reloj.
Los intervalos de comprobación de estado, el almacenamiento en caché de DNS y las actualizaciones del plano de control se propagan a diferentes velocidades. Durante un incidente, el tráfico se distribuye de forma desigual. Algunos usuarios acceden a puntos finales en buen estado, mientras que otros son redirigidos a puntos finales degradados debido al almacenamiento en caché de DNS o a las actualizaciones de estado retrasadas.
Esto crea breves periodos de experiencia degradada que afectan directamente a las transacciones y a la continuidad de la sesión.
Integración de la coherencia en los servicios de red basados en la nube
Para escalar los servicios de red basados en la nube, es necesario alinear el comportamiento entre los distintos proveedores en lugar de replicar las configuraciones.
Una capa de control unificada define cómo debe fluir el tráfico en función de la latencia y la disponibilidad. Las comprobaciones de estado deben operar en la misma capa con umbrales idénticos para que cada región responda de forma coherente ante la degradación. La lógica de reintento debe controlarse para evitar la amplificación durante fallos parciales.
La gestión de las conexiones también es importante. Los tiempos de espera por inactividad, la configuración de mantenimiento de conexión y las políticas de drenaje deben estar alineados para evitar caídas abruptas de sesión durante los eventos de escalado.
La observabilidad debe reflejar la experiencia del usuario. El rastreo distribuido y la monitorización de usuarios reales revelan cómo se mueven las solicitudes entre regiones y dónde se originan los retrasos.
Deficiencias comunes que aún afectan la producción
La mayoría de los problemas en entornos multinube no se deben a la falta de infraestructura, sino a pequeñas inconsistencias en la configuración y la aplicación del comportamiento de la red entre los distintos proveedores
- Las rutas de tráfico a través de las nubes no están optimizadas ni son visibles
- Los controles de salud utilizan diferentes protocolos y umbrales según el proveedor
- El comportamiento de reintento es inconsistente, lo que provoca picos de latencia bajo carga
- El DNS y la sincronización de la conmutación por error no están sincronizados
Impulsando el crecimiento de la industria con las conexiones adecuadas
Las organizaciones que ofrecen soluciones basadas en la nube aún necesitan llegar a compradores, socios y clientes potenciales cualificados relevantes dentro de su sector. Conectar con el público adecuado dentro de su sector ayuda a convertir el interés en oportunidades concretas y a generar nuevas oportunidades de negocio.
Cómo lograr que los servicios de red basados en la nube sean predecibles en diferentes nubes
El rendimiento en entornos multinube se estabiliza cuando el comportamiento del tráfico se controla de extremo a extremo.
Una vez que se alinean las políticas de enrutamiento, las señales de estado y los tiempos de conmutación por error, un servicio de red basado en la nube funciona de manera consistente en todos los entornos. El rendimiento se vuelve predecible y los problemas de producción son más fáciles de aislar y resolver

